Service interruption via quadratic Markdown parsing
Published Mar 28, 2023 · Updated Feb 18, 2025
Uncontrolled resource consumption in Comrak before 0.17.0 allows remote attackers to interrupt services via crafted Markdown. Its inline, emphasis, link, HTML, list, reference, and autolink parsing paths repeatedly process pathological constructs, producing quadratic CPU growth. Exposure requires an application to pass attacker-controlled Markdown to Comrak; processing can monopolize CPU and delay or deny service without affecting data confidentiality or integrity.
